About this Book:
This book systematically explains the
basic principles and techniques involved in the design of reinforced concrete
structures. It exhaustively covers the first course on the subject at B. E. /
B. Tech level.
Important features:
Exposition is based on the latest Indian
standard code IS: 456-2000.
Limit state method emphasized throughout
the book.
Working stress method also explained.
Detailing aspects of reinforcement
highlighted.
Incorporates earthquake resistant
design.
Includes a large number of solved
examples, practice problems and illustrations.
The book would serve as a comprehensive
text for undergraduate civil engineering students. Practising engineers would
also find it a valuable reference source.
About the Author
N Krishna Raju, Emeritus Professor of
Civil Engineering, M S Ramaiah Institute of Technology, Bangalore, earned his
PhD degree from the University of Leeds, UK. He has taught at the College of
Engineering, Guindy, Chennai; Regional Engineering College, Calicut; Lanchester
College of Technology, Coventry, UK; Indian Institute of Science, Bangalore and
the Karnataka Regional Engineering College, Surathkal. He was also Visiting
Professor at the University of Basra, Iraq, during 1979–82.
Dr. Raju is the recipient of several
awards, prominent among them being the Sir Bowen Memorial Prize, Garudacharya
and Krishna Iyengar Gold Medals, UP Govt. National Award, Birla Super Endowment
Award, Eminent Civil Engineers Award, George Oomen Memorial Prize, Institution
of Engineers Prize, Naghadi Award and the ICI Silver Jubilee Award.
Dr. Raju has published over 60 research
papers in reputed journals and is the author of Design of Concrete Mixes,
Prestressed Concrete, Design of Reinforced Concrete Structures, Advanced Reinforced
Concrete Design, Design of Bridges, Design and Drawing of Reinforced Concrete
and Steel Structures, Numerical Methods for Engineering Problems, Structural
Design and Drawing, Prestressed Concrete (Problems and Solutions), Advanced
Mechanics of Solids and Structures and Prestressed Concrete Bridges.
The textbook Prestressed Concrete has
been translated in the Indonesian Language and published by M/s. Penerbet
Erlangga, Jakarta in 1986. Another manograph entitled Advanced Reinforced
Concrete Design has been translated in Arabic language and published by the
Razi University Press, Iran. He is also a Member of the Institution of
Structural Engineers, London, UK, the Institution of Engineers, India, the
Indian Concrete Institute and he is socially active serving as the President of
the Vijayanagar Senior Citizen’s Forum and an active anchor of Jai Maruthi
Laughter Club at Vijayanagar, Bangalore.
R. N. Pranesh is currently Assistant
Professor in Civil Engineering, M. S. Ramaiah Institute of Technology,
Bangalore. He earned his B. E. degree from the University of Mysore and M. E.
degree in Structures from the University of Bangalore. He is actively involved
in design and rehabilitation of buildings, research on high performance
concrete, fly ash concrete and innovative and low-cost construction technology.
He is a member of the Indian Concrete Institute and the Indian Society for
Technical Education.
